With the harsh North Country winters, do you offer any special grooming packages for cold weather?

Absolutely. Our 'Winter Ready' package includes a moisturizing oatmeal bath to combat dry skin, a paw pad trim and conditioner to prevent ice ball buildup, and a blow-dry that ensures your pet is completely dry before heading back into the cold. We also offer a safe, non-toxic paw wax application to protect against road salt and ice.

Are there specific times of year you recommend a de-shedding treatment for local outdoor or working dogs?

Given the distinct seasonal changes in the Adirondack foothills, we highly recommend a major de-shedding treatment during the spring (late April/May) as dogs lose their winter undercoat, and a lighter one in the fall (October) as they prepare for winter. This is especially beneficial for local working breeds and outdoor dogs to help regulate their body temperature and maintain healthy skin.

Now, let's talk about the spa side. Our environment is beautiful but tough on a dog's coat. Think about it: splashing in the Black River, rolling in leaf litter, and that infamous red clay. A professional spa service does more than just make your pup smell nice. It includes a deep-clean bath that removes allergens, a thorough brush-out to prevent painful mats (especially for our double-coated breeds), and a nail trim to protect those paws on rocky paths. It’s preventative care that keeps your dog comfortable and healthy.
